I have this Boss Pedal that is overdrive and distortion...you can mix it however you like on it. I got it when I first got into playing guitar and now I don't really like it. Now I have two questions. First how would I set this thing to boost my already distorted crate amp up enough to solo over the rest of the band, and two...if I can't do that how much should I ask for it when I sell it.

I would use it as an overdrive and have the level up pretty high and the gain down pretty low and use the tone to make it stand out more. You probably wont get much of a volume boost, but it will make your guitar cut through the mix better. Just make sure the gain isn't so high that it muddies things up.
